Short description of error
in an animation objects pop in and pop out through animating the "disable viewport"-property.
When i move the slider of the timeline through a disabled viewport, the keyframes in the timeline become disabled, even if i drag it further to when it gets enabled again.
To get the keyframes back i have to select the object once again.

in dope-sheet there is a "display hidden"-toggle, perhaps this could be used in the timeline too?

Exact steps for others to reproduce the error

The Cube is selected
Move the Playhead in the timeline and the keyframes disappear
